Abstract

The present invention relates to the methods for receiving radio signal.The reference information (108) of the signal quality obtained in reference time point about radio signal is read in first method step at this.The signal message (110) of the signal quality obtained in current point in time about radio signal is received in another method step.The signal quality obtained in current point in time finally is examined using signal message (110) and reference information (108) in third method step, to determine the reproduction quality of radio signal.

Background technique
Use amplitude modulation that usually there is function of search as the AM radio receiver of modulation system, with from set reception Frequency starts to adjust a now receivable transmitter of laying equal stress on.The frequency stepping that frequency can fix is received herein to improve or drop It is low.It can for example be examined in new reception frequency now, receive whether field intensity is greater than threshold value and other show the matter of interference Whether magnitude is less than threshold value.If all standards all meet, it can terminate to search for, wherein reappearing using current frequency.

Radio signal can be regarded as amplitude-modulated signal, as the long-wave signal, medium wave signal or shortwave of radio transmitter are believed Number.The signal quality of radio signal can for example pass through the interference or nothing of the reception field intensity, radio signal of radio signal The reception field intensities of the adjacent signals of line electric signal characterizes.Reference time point can be regarded as before the current point in time when Between point.Such as the step of reading, can be repeated with predetermined rhythm, to read multiple reference informations, wherein each reference The signal quality acquired in other each reference time points of information expression radio signal.Reference information for example can be preparatory It is stored in determining time period in suitable memory (also referred to as scene memory).The step of reading and receiving can It is carried out simultaneously or successively with random order.In the step of examining for example radio can be examined by means of different threshold value comparisons The signal quality acquired in current point in time of signal.Threshold value as used herein is selectable such that radio signal in success Inspection in have sufficiently high reproduction quality.
The understanding that the aspect introduced herein is based on is that can examine according to the pervious signal quality of radio signal can The signal quality of received radio signal.Thus the fluctuation of relevant to receiving time signal quality can be obtained and can be wireless It is taken in the inspection of electric signal.Such as the function of search for controlling radio receiver can be examined in this way, make The different receiving times obtained in radio signal ensure good reproduction quality always.
The reception of especially AM transmitter can be highly dependent on the daily time.On daytime due in long-wave band, medium wave band It can be received with the relatively small number of transmitter of decaying in the daytime in shortwave segment limit, and obviously have at dusk and at night More transmitters can be received.However many transmitters may be lost by serious field intensity, English decline The interference of (englisch Fading), adjacent frequency or the influence of other electromagnetic interferences.
This signal decaying depending on the daily time can take in the following manner in transmitter search now, I.e. not only to current obtained signal quality variable (such as receiving field intensity) or other show that the mass value of interference makes sound It answers, and additionally using the signal message being stored in scene memory, to determine the corresponding quality of reception of transmitter.Signal Information can for example obtain in the independent signal processing path by reproduction path.
Search can be designed such as to any time in one day in this way all with quality of reception weight good enough Existing transmitter.

According to the present embodiment, device 100 is configured to running control software to control signal processing path 202,204.This Outer device 100 reads the value determined in information provider unit 212,218.These values may include reference information 108,118,120 And signal message 110.Furthermore device 100 controls high frequency processing unit 206,214 to adjust different reception frequencies.
Device 100 can be implemented with so-called scene memory, wherein to each AM receive frequency storage about The a plurality of record of correspondingly received field intensity and corresponding interference information together with temporal information.Such as scene memory is configured to So that receiving frequency for each AM stores ten different records.If receiving frequency for specific AM has existed ten notes Record covers corresponding earliest value then in order to record new value.
Device 100 controls second signal processing path 204 as follows, i.e., with fixed timing scheme or ought not be by The second signal processing path receives frequency operation with the AM supported by radio receiver when other tasks need.It is each herein AM adjusted receives the reception field intensity of frequency and interference information is recorded in scene memory together with timestamp.
Device 100 reads scene memory with fixed rhythm.It is configurable for according to those being more than certain in this device 100 A field intensity threshold value and the inspection threshold value searched for lower than the determination of the quantity of the transmitter of some interference threshold for AM.If scene Memory include it is less can good received transmitter, then examine threshold value correspondingly to be turned down.If opposite many transmitters Being can be good received, then examines threshold value to be correspondingly raised.
According to one embodiment, device 100 is configured to when the user for responding radio receiver starts AM search Second signal processing path 204 is activated immediately.Thus reproduction path 202 (also referred to as reproduction RX path or reproducing signal path) On be activated on the direction that user defines to the current search for receiving frequency.Determining reception field intensity value and dry herein It disturbs the value of information and is recorded in together with timestamp in scene memory.
After a brief delay, present device 100 also starts to search in reproduction path 202.Herein in each reception Current reception field intensity value and current mass value are determined in frequency, as received the interference or adjacent reception frequency of frequency Receive field intensity.If receiving field intensity is lower than identified inspection threshold value (alternatively referred to as searching threshold), device 100 is adjusted To next reception frequency.The inspection is re-started now.It is determined if next reception field intensity for receiving frequency is higher than Inspection threshold value, then device 100 examines scene memory to all records and each adjacent letter of set reception frequency The record in road.Only consider that those are no more than the record of such as 10,15 or 30 minutes predetermined timeliness herein.
The case where according to embodiment, device 100 are examined one or more in following standard now.
First, device 100 examines the reception field intensity being stored in scene memory (including currently determining reception field strength Degree) variation whether be less than preset deviation threshold.
Second, device 100 examines the interference information being stored in scene memory (including currently determining interference information) Interference average value whether be less than preset interference threshold.
Third, device 100 examine the field intensity average value for the adjacent channel reception field intensity being stored in scene memory Whether at most than the reception field intensity currently amount that have more one fixed.
If radio receiver is mobile radio reception device in the car, device 100 is configurable for basis The respective threshold of the travel speed control criteria given above of vehicle.If stationary vehicle, field intensity variation and interference letter The threshold value of breath is lowerly settable.If vehicle movement, threshold value can be correspondingly improved.
It is received by the way that whether the determining transmitter in currently reception frequency of the first standard is fluctuated with higher field intensity.Such as The fruit situation is true, then does not reappear current reception frequency.By the average interference information of the second criterion evaluation, than primary Property measurement view more precisely is provided.Inhibit the transmitter with very strong adjacent channel by third standard, because herein must In view of receiving interference as caused by adjacent channel.
When all criteria given above are all satisfied, the AM that device 100 stops in reproduction path 202 is searched for and is made With set reception frequency for reappearing.
